About the Role
We are looking for a detail-oriented and motivated Junior Accounts Assistant to support our finance team. This is a fantastic opportunity for someone looking to start or build a career in accounting.
Key Responsibilities
Process incoming supplier invoices accurately and in a timely manner for all production shoots.
Chase suppliers for outstanding invoices to ensure timely processing and avoid payment delays
Respond to supplier queries and maintain positive relationships
Support the finance & production team with administrative and ad hoc tasks
Review data to ensure accuracy of data input and prioritises projects in order of importance
Track cost expenditure on production projects and chase outstanding expenses with both producer and supplier.
Update various data including financial information, account detail and customer information on inhouse billing systems.
Communicate discrepancies to producer and accounts team.
Monthly Credit Card Reconciliation.
Accounts email management, ensuring all emails are resolved within the agreed SLA timescale
